This four-panel collage lays out a single wedding palette across bouquets, boutonnière and a sculptural centerpiece with thoughtful restraint and a hint of local character. The bride's bouquet, shown close-up in the top-left frame, centres on creamy white oriental lilies-some unfurled to show their stamens, some still coyly closed-alongside pale double lisianthus whose edges glow with a delicate purple rim. Small, upright spikes of deep purple accents thread like punctuation through the blossoms, while mixed greens from wispy grasses to broader leaves give the arrangement a natural, garden-like rhythm. The photograph's soft, diffused light bathes the petals and makes the white tones feel luminous against the subtle purple notes. The top-right panel focuses on the groom's charcoal grey suit lapel where a boutonnière has been scaled down with care: one open purple-edged lisianthus, a neat lily bud, a touch of spiky purple accent and a few linear green stems, secured with a petite white bow and set against a rich purple silk tie. A smaller, hand-tied bridesmaid bouquet on beige fabric appears in the bottom-left, mirroring the main bouquet's textures and stem-wrapping. The bottom-right reveals a tall arrangement in a white woven spherical vase, abundant with lilies, lisianthus and cascading foliage, placed beside two woven beige spheres as contemporary table décor. Celebrate your love story in effortless style with our Today, Tomorrow, Forever Wedding Collection from Florist Hampstead Garden Suburb. Designed for modern, romantic couples, this premium wedding flower package brings together fragrant, chic blooms carefully arranged for a beautifully coordinated look across your special day.

Choose from three flexible packages tailored to your guest list: the Intimate Package for 50-75 guests, the Original Package for 75-100 guests, and the Ultimate Package for 100+ guests. Each option includes a stunning bridal bouquet, elegant bridesmaid bouquets, refined corsages and groom boutonnieres, ensuring every key moment and photo is flawlessly framed with luxury flowers.
